Masterpieces of Rossini will sound at the Tchaikovsky Hall

On 03 Mar 2017 Moscow Philharmonic will continue to acquaint its listeners with the stars of the world Opera and will offer a concert of famous canadian singer contralto, mezzo-soprano Marie-Nicole Lemieux, who has gained prominence since 2000 and is now performing on the best world stages. The singer will be accompanied by the Russian national orchestra (conductor is also canadian, young Maestro Jean-Marie Zeitouni). The entire concert will be dedicated to music of the great Italian composer Gioacchino Rossini, who reflected in his work the liberating impulse of the Italian people of the period of the unification of Italy.

Gioachino Antonio Rossini, 1792 – 1868 is Italian composer born into a musical family of conductor and singer. He worked in Bologna in churches and theatres as a conductor and accompanist. During the revolution he was a member of the National guard; carbonaro. Rossini was recognized during his life. He lived and worked in Italy (as head of theatre Italien and Music Lyceum in Bologna) and France (as Royal composer and General inspector of singing). The main creativity of Rossini was Opera, he brought there the spirit of reformation. Both in the Opera Buffa (“the Barber of Seville”) and Opera Seria (“Othello”), he greatly enriched it.

The Director of the concert Mikhail Fichtenholz told the readers of the cultural-political magazine “E-Vesti” that “the Russian national orchestra performs regularly with singers of the world level and was chosen for the debut concert of Mrs. Lemieux. It is no coincidence: during the last several years in the framework of the Big festival RNO plays seldom Rossini’s Opera with the legendary Italian conductor Alberto Zedda. Musicians of the RNO have extensive experience in the Rossini music, so the collaboration of the orchestra and Marie-Nicole Lemieux promises a great future”.

According to him, the choice of compositions was made by Marie-Nicole Lemieux, who “built the program on the contrast of serious and comic operas of Rossini – and if the comic Operas (“the Italian girl in Algiers” and “the Barber of Seville”) are quite well known to the General public, then the excerpts from a serious, dramatic works of the composer are real rarities. Stylistically, these things are very different from each other – but in any case they require incredibly virtuosic vocal techniques”.

The performance of musicians in Moscow will be a premiere, and even talk about the continuation of cooperation is in the pipeline. “Both musicians perform in Moscow for the first time, – said M. Fikhtengolts, Marie-Nicole is one of the most exciting singers of her generation. She’s well known in the world for her interpretation of Baroque music and Rossini. Together with Maestro Zeitouni she recorded not long ago album of Opera arias by Rossini, fragments from which they will present in Moscow. At the moment there is no concrete plans for our future collaboration, but the Moscow debut of Marie-Nicole Lemieux will surely become a reference point in negotiations on further projects.”

The program will include recitals, cavatina and arias from the works of G. Rossini, which are chef-d’euvres of international Opera: “the Barber of Seville,” “the Italian in Algeria”, “William tell”, etc.
